Hi,<div><br></div><div>I am new to Qt &amp; PyQt. Can anybody suggest what is the best Framework for GUI Automation on Qt Apps. </div><div><br></div><div>I have tried Froglogic&#39;s Squish but it is a recording tool. I am looking for programmable &amp; object-based GUI test automation method .</div>
<div><br></div><div>Requirements:</div><div>1. Method should be object based not co-ordinate based.</div><div>2. Method should allow programming not just recording the test &amp; Playing it.</div><div>3. Method should allow me to launch &amp; kill applications like (browser/media player) through mouse clicks &amp; keypad events.</div>
<div>4. Method should allow me to type some letters into the textbox (Example: Typing in Browser text bar)</div><div><br></div><div>Can I do it with PyQt. Please suggest me some way.</div><div><br></div><div>Any help would be greatly appreciated. Thanks in advance.</div>
<div><br></div><div>-Praveen</div>